summ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Sterrett <mr_bones_@gentoo.org>2004-11-06 04:07:05 +0000
committerMichael Sterrett <mr_bones_@gentoo.org>2004-11-06 04:07:05 +0000
commit0c9b103695803eb820223abfaeef8f189633c71b (patch)
tree48e3976b7b116f5d38025787f9e266e4ef6f3ad7 /media-libs/libsdl
parentbumpity bump bump (diff)
downloadhistorical-0c9b103695803eb820223abfaeef8f189633c71b.tar.gz
historical-0c9b103695803eb820223abfaeef8f189633c71b.tar.bz2
historical-0c9b103695803eb820223abfaeef8f189633c71b.zip
stable for x86; use toolchain-funcs; tidy
Diffstat (limited to 'media-libs/libsdl')
-rw-r--r--media-libs/libsdl/ChangeLog5
-rw-r--r--media-libs/libsdl/Manifest22
-rw-r--r--media-libs/libsdl/libsdl-1.2.7-r3.ebuild23
3 files changed, 26 insertions, 24 deletions
diff --git a/media-libs/libsdl/ChangeLog b/media-libs/libsdl/ChangeLog
index cd1c4cd49c86..456ddda743d6 100644
--- a/media-libs/libsdl/ChangeLog
+++ b/media-libs/libsdl/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for media-libs/libsdl
# Copyright 2002-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libsdl/ChangeLog,v 1.60 2004/10/01 10:19:07 kugelfang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libsdl/ChangeLog,v 1.61 2004/11/06 04:07:05 mr_bones_ Exp $
+
+ 05 Nov 2004; Michael Sterrett <mr_bones_@gentoo.org> libsdl-1.2.7-r3.ebuild:
+ stable for x86; use toolchain-funcs; tidy
01 Oct 2004; Danny van Dyk <kugelfang@gentoo.org> libsdl-1.2.6-r3.ebuild,
libsdl-1.2.7-r1.ebuild, libsdl-1.2.7-r2.ebuild, libsdl-1.2.7-r3.ebuild,
diff --git a/media-libs/libsdl/Manifest b/media-libs/libsdl/Manifest
index a79724c435ea..a76b0c3f6204 100644
--- a/media-libs/libsdl/Manifest
+++ b/media-libs/libsdl/Manifest
@@ -1,21 +1,21 @@
-MD5 2d0f23c9876b580e5afc0823267498db ChangeLog 9127
+MD5 fe0a3840517bd6cbc4248060279bd234 ChangeLog 9251
+MD5 baaaa69f33ef9027dac84ee4ff02773b metadata.xml 974
MD5 ca3bfcb303f4ddb5c6f708f377e4dc61 libsdl-1.2.6-r3.ebuild 2900
-MD5 df227c0b42516d12513e066ac110c1ca libsdl-1.2.7.ebuild 2531
MD5 894fae13cc92aaec797c7eee55743d1d libsdl-1.2.7-r1.ebuild 2823
-MD5 baaaa69f33ef9027dac84ee4ff02773b metadata.xml 974
MD5 cd95873b9f837770c2fb0928b69536aa libsdl-1.2.7-r2.ebuild 3721
-MD5 4dcb2e6fa58d4b163847c26f08deef83 libsdl-1.2.7-r3.ebuild 3737
-MD5 0c2020ec3ce37ea0612064c52d1014b1 files/1.2.6-alsa-1.0.0.patch 557
-MD5 4f1ce33c931d461bed06277f60341085 files/1.2.6-nobuggy-X.patch 568
-MD5 4f1ce33c931d461bed06277f60341085 files/1.2.7-nobuggy-X.patch 568
-MD5 b66ce90b8939cef871c1c9b065fc0658 files/digest-libsdl-1.2.6-r3 62
-MD5 2e9d99f7ab858b5a64d124abea4565b9 files/digest-libsdl-1.2.7 62
-MD5 419d8c241f85b4deba895c615faa5612 files/libsdl-1.2.6-fullscreen.patch 1094
+MD5 df227c0b42516d12513e066ac110c1ca libsdl-1.2.7.ebuild 2531
+MD5 8db12d6d6a4e925af2fbb8554ad4cb24 libsdl-1.2.7-r3.ebuild 3760
MD5 803844293dc7df2bb7d2323c03977b71 files/1.2.7-libcaca.patch 23266
MD5 2e9d99f7ab858b5a64d124abea4565b9 files/digest-libsdl-1.2.7-r1 62
+MD5 0c2020ec3ce37ea0612064c52d1014b1 files/1.2.6-alsa-1.0.0.patch 557
+MD5 2e9d99f7ab858b5a64d124abea4565b9 files/digest-libsdl-1.2.7 62
MD5 206ddd08dd3e33819d03245d11af3014 files/1.2.7-gcc34.patch 8196
MD5 e71ab5ce20cb7c70631a59f9d209cce1 files/1.2.7-joystick.patch 1317
-MD5 71a857d2bbcc34c4807638eb5d710f2e files/1.2.7-26headers.patch 1017
+MD5 b66ce90b8939cef871c1c9b065fc0658 files/digest-libsdl-1.2.6-r3 62
+MD5 419d8c241f85b4deba895c615faa5612 files/libsdl-1.2.6-fullscreen.patch 1094
+MD5 4f1ce33c931d461bed06277f60341085 files/1.2.6-nobuggy-X.patch 568
+MD5 4f1ce33c931d461bed06277f60341085 files/1.2.7-nobuggy-X.patch 568
MD5 abf0c6fe9d93e5b0cc9a4dbb6d93ad87 files/1.2.7-joystick2.patch 16196
MD5 2e9d99f7ab858b5a64d124abea4565b9 files/digest-libsdl-1.2.7-r2 62
+MD5 71a857d2bbcc34c4807638eb5d710f2e files/1.2.7-26headers.patch 1017
MD5 2e9d99f7ab858b5a64d124abea4565b9 files/digest-libsdl-1.2.7-r3 62
diff --git a/media-libs/libsdl/libsdl-1.2.7-r3.ebuild b/media-libs/libsdl/libsdl-1.2.7-r3.ebuild
index 9059f9d4f361..36e247ce6024 100644
--- a/media-libs/libsdl/libsdl-1.2.7-r3.ebuild
+++ b/media-libs/libsdl/libsdl-1.2.7-r3.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2004 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libsdl/libsdl-1.2.7-r3.ebuild,v 1.2 2004/10/01 10:19:07 kugelfang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libsdl/libsdl-1.2.7-r3.ebuild,v 1.3 2004/11/06 04:07:05 mr_bones_ Exp $
-inherit fixheadtails eutils gnuconfig
+inherit toolchain-funcs fixheadtails eutils gnuconfig
DESCRIPTION="Simple Direct Media Layer"
HOMEPAGE="http://www.libsdl.org/"
@@ -10,7 +10,7 @@ SRC_URI="http://www.libsdl.org/release/SDL-${PV}.tar.gz"
LICENSE="LGPL-2"
SLOT="0"
-KEYWORDS="~x86 ~ppc ~sparc ~alpha ~hppa ~amd64 ~ia64 ~ppc64"
+KEYWORDS="~alpha ~amd64 ~hppa ~ia64 ~ppc ~ppc64 ~sparc x86"
IUSE="oss alsa esd arts nas X dga xv xinerama fbcon directfb ggi svga aalib opengl libcaca noaudio novideo nojoystick"
# if you disable audio/video/joystick and something breaks, you pick up the pieces
@@ -43,13 +43,13 @@ pkg_setup() {
src_unpack() {
unpack ${A}
- cd ${S}
+ cd "${S}"
- epatch ${FILESDIR}/${PV}-nobuggy-X.patch #30089
- epatch ${FILESDIR}/${PV}-libcaca.patch #40224
- epatch ${FILESDIR}/${PV}-gcc34.patch #48947
- epatch ${FILESDIR}/${PV}-joystick2.patch #52833
- epatch ${FILESDIR}/${PV}-26headers.patch #58192
+ epatch "${FILESDIR}/${PV}-nobuggy-X.patch" #30089
+ epatch "${FILESDIR}/${PV}-libcaca.patch" #40224
+ epatch "${FILESDIR}/${PV}-gcc34.patch" #48947
+ epatch "${FILESDIR}/${PV}-joystick2.patch" #52833
+ epatch "${FILESDIR}/${PV}-26headers.patch" #58192
ht_fix_file configure.in
@@ -60,12 +60,11 @@ src_unpack() {
fi
./autogen.sh || die "autogen failed"
-
gnuconfig_update
}
src_compile() {
- local myconf=""
+ local myconf=
use noaudio && myconf="${myconf} --disable-audio"
use novideo \
&& myconf="${myconf} --disable-video" \
@@ -78,7 +77,7 @@ src_compile() {
# dependency loop, only link against DirectFB if it
# isn't broken #61592
echo 'int main(){}' > directfb-test.c
- $(gcc-getCC) directfb-test.c -ldirectfb 2>/dev/null \
+ $(tc-getCC) directfb-test.c -ldirectfb 2>/dev/null \
&& directfbconf="--enable-video-directfb" \
|| ewarn "Disabling DirectFB since libdirectfb.so is broken"
fi